About the role
Responsibilities
- Interview HIV-diagnosed persons to identify exposed partners
- Locate, notify, and test partners in mobile settings
- Connect newly diagnosed persons to HIV clinical care
- Trace and re-engage out-of-care HIV-diagnosed persons
- Support HIV prevention, PrEP linkage, and ancillary services
- Collect surveillance and case investigation data
- Serve in emergency response assignments as needed
